My favorite long running brick joke was Stan's fear of seagulls: American Dream Factory (season 2): Stan admits to being afraid of seagulls. Meter Made (season 3): Stan has a nightmare about seagulls who can drive. Choosy Wives Choose Smith (season 4): Stan overcomes his fear of seagulls https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=BdGr7ql4cgI
